Real-Life Embroidery Performance: A Practical Walkthrough

Let’s talk about stitching it out. I’m thinking of a specific scenario: preparing a custom embroidered canvas tote bag as a holiday gift for a nurse friend. The design’s central, bold statement means hoop placement is straightforward. On a flat surface like a tote, it will stitch cleanly. The challenge, as with any design containing text, will be in the small details. The lettering needs to be crisp. On a textured fabric like canvas, using a proper stabilizer is non-negotiable to prevent puckering and ensure the stitch density holds up.

For machine embroidery, the design’s potential fill stitch areas (like the heart element) would need to be tested on scrap fabric first to gauge thread consumption and time. On thinner fabrics like standard t-shirts, the stitch density must be balanced to avoid weighing down the material. For stretchy fabrics, again, stabilizer choice is key. On darker fabric backgrounds, thread color contrast becomes paramount; a bright white or a vibrant color palette would make this design pop.

Caution Zones: Where to Pay Extra Attention

This design shines on larger, flat areas. Some applications require more careful planning. Embroidering it on a curved surface like a cap would mean paying close attention to the design’s orientation and potentially simplifying very tiny decorative accents to maintain clarity. If adapting it for very small hoop sizes, some of the detail might need to be scaled or slightly modified to prevent overcrowding.

For products that need frequent washing, like apparel or kitchen towels, the integrity of the stitches over time is a consideration. A well-executed embroidery with good thread and proper technique will hold up, but it’s a reminder to always test the design on scrap fabric first, mimicking the final product’s material. This is a fundamental step for any embroidery project destined for a small shop product or commercial embroidery work.

Essential Designer Notes Before You Hoop Up

My final thoughts are a checklist from the bench. Always check thread color contrast. Run a test not just on light fabric, but on a dark background scrap too. Inspect the small details in the design file on screen—are there any corners or tiny elements that might become lost or tangled in stitches? Use the provided mockup to visualize, but also create your own black and white mockups to assess form without color.

Confirm your hoop size can accommodate the design comfortably. Most importantly, since this is provided as a PNG file, understand its intended use. It’s a print-ready graphic, fantastic for certain applications. For machine embroidery, you would need to convert it to an appropriate embroidery file format, which involves considering stitch types like satin stitch for borders or running stitch for details. Before selling any finished product or using it in commercial embroidery projects, absolutely confirm the licensing terms of the original design asset. This protects your craft business and respects the creator.
